Jennifer (“Jenna”) Grace Fish, born March 02, 2003, passed away in her home on November 27, 2020, as a result of accidental carbon monoxide poisoning. Only seventeen years old, Jenna possessed kind-hearted compassion for others, high standards, and dedication to her earthly family and Heavenly Father. Jenna was radiant and beautiful inside and out.
Jenna is best described by the words of King Solomon in Proverbs 3:15, “She is more precious than jewels, and nothing you desire compares with her.”
We will be working towards heightening awareness regarding the dangers of carbon monoxide as well as the importance of ensuring heating and cooling systems perpetuate fresh air flow into all homes. In the spring, a weeping willow tree will be planted at LuceLine Orchard in Watertown, MN. Flowers from Jenna’s home garden will be transplanted at the base of the tree and surround a bench with the inscription of Psalm 1:3, “He shall be like a tree planted by the rivers of water, that brings forth its fruit in its season; whose leaf also shall not whither, and whatsoever he doeth shall prosper.”
The proceeds from this Go Fund Me will be used to take care of Jenna's medical bills and funeral costs. The remaining funds will used to maintain Jenna's Legacy of raising awareness of the dangers of carbon monoxide in the home and the importance of properly working detectors. To protect another family from experiencing this tragedy will be Jenna's Legacy.
